Abstract

The utility model relates to an ankle joint bending and stretching exerciser. The structure includes a footplate, a speed reducing motor, a motor pedestal, a base plate, two rocking arm racks, two L-shaped rocking arms, an eccentric sheave, a rocking arm shaft, a footplate shaft, a screw hole elevator, an elevating screw rod, a guide hole elevator, an elevating guide rod and an adjusting turn button. When the ankle joint bending and stretching exerciser is in use, the speed reducing motor drives the L-shaped rocking arms to do an arc reciprocating motion around a rotating shaft through the eccentric sheave, the front end of the bending arm of an L-shaped rocking arm drives a footplate to do an arc reciprocating motion, thereby a heel is forced to rotate around the ankle joint, lower limb muscle is driven to do a bending and stretching motion, lower limb blood is promoted to flow back to the heart, and the formation of lower limb deep veins thrombus of a bedridden surgical operation patient is prevented. The design is reasonable, the bending and stretching amplitude is adjustable, the bending and stretching amplitude can be adjusted by coarse and fine adjustment, a low-voltage direct current planetary gear type speed reducing motor is selected, which is safe and reliable, and the bending and stretching frequency can be adjusted by adjusting the rotating speed of the motor. The ankle joint bending and stretching exerciser is specially suitable for helping a bedridden patient to do an ankle joint motion.

Background technology
Human body is under normal condition, and lower limb muscles is the ankle joint flexion and extension when walking, drives lower limb muscles and shrinks the vein that can oppress lower limb, helps extruding lower limb blood heart to reflux, and especially the effect of Calf muscle is the most obvious.The most bed rest time of surgical patient is long clinically, causes lower limb muscles not move, and blood flow slows down, and forms thrombosis at IC easily.The probability that deep vein thrombosis of lower extremity takes place orthopaedics operation on joint patient is very high, in a single day big thrombosis comes off from blood vessel, the blood vessel of meeting thromboembolism lungs, and dead probability is very high.So keep bed patient's ankle joint movable, have the important clinical meaning.

The ankle joint flexion and extension device of this utility model comprises sole, reducing motor and motor cabinet, also comprises base plate, base, 2 rocker stands, 2 L shaped rocking arms, eccentric, rocker arm shaft, sole axle, screw elevator, lifting screw, guide hole elevator, lifting guide pillar and adjusting knobs; Said L shaped rocking arm is made up of vertical arm and bend arm, and vertically the arm upper end is provided with rotation hole, and vertically the arm middle and lower part is provided with cannelure; Vertically the arm lower end is connected with bend arm and is provided with the rocker hole; The bend arm front end is provided with square sole hole, and wherein, base is installed on the base plate; 2 rocker stand bottoms are installed in the base two ends and are fixedly connected with base plate; 2 rocker stand upper ends are respectively equipped with a turning cylinder, and 2 L shaped rocking arm upper ends are lifted on 2 turning cylinders through rotation hole respectively, and the rocker arm shaft two ends are packed on the rocker hole of 2 L shaped rocking arm lower ends; And be provided with the corresponding arc of rocker arm shaft swing curve in the rocker stand bottom and wave the hole; Sole axle two ends are fixedly connected with the square sole hole of the bend arm front end that stretches out rocker stand, and the sole bottom is fixedly mounted on the sole axle, and reducing motor is contained on the motor cabinet; The reducing motor output shaft stretches out motor cabinet and is fixedly connected with the eccentric centre bore; Eccentric shaft on the eccentric is installed in the cannelure of L shaped rocking arm, the parallel motor cabinet both sides that are packed in of screw elevator with the guide hole elevator, and lifting guide pillar is inserted in the up-down guide hole of guide hole elevator and is installed on the rocker stand; The lifting screw spinning is in the up-down screw of screw elevator and be installed on the rocker stand, and an end of lifting screw is connected with the adjusting knob that stretches out rocker stand.
Bend and stretch amplitude and make the amplitude of bending and stretching can be adjustable continuously in the reasonable scope in order to enlarge ankle joint; Angle β between line between the rotation hole of said L shaped rocking arm and the square sole hole and the vertical arm is 40~50 °; Vertically the length of arm is 110~130 mm, and the length of cannelure is 60~70 mm.Said eccentric is provided with 4 eccentric orfices, and the distance of 4 eccentric orfices and centre bore is elected 9mm, 11mm, 13mm and 15mm respectively as.
In order to prevent that sole from leaving sole, can on said sole, be provided with the frenulum hole, so that foot and sole are tied,, can cover plate be housed in the rocker stand outside for attractive in appearance and safety with frenulum.
This utility model ankle joint flexion and extension device; During use; Reducing motor drives the L shaped rocking arm moving axis that rotates through eccentric and makes arc and move back and forth, and the front end of L shaped rocking arm then drives sole and makes arc and move back and forth, and then forces heel to rotate and drive lower limb muscles and do flexion and extension around ankle joint; Promote lower limb blood heart to reflux, can effectively prevent the formation of the surgical patient generation deep vein thrombosis of lower extremity of long-term bed.Because reasonable in design, the amplitude of bending and stretching is adjustable, both can carry out coarse adjustment to the amplitude of bending and stretching, and can carry out fine tuning again, selects low-voltage direct planetary gear type reducing motor for use, and is safe and reliable, adjusting motor speed also scalable bends and stretches frequency.Be particularly suitable for helping the bed patient to carry out the movable use of ankle joint.
